Thanks very much Jeff, Brice, and Nate for the kind words...thankyou.gif

I have been longing for a 6105-8110 for quite some time, but as you know, we WIS tend to loose focus on a regular basis.

Now keep in mind that this piece is not 100% original and is one of the refurbished options that you see from many sellers out there on "the bay"...I tried to go with a seller that had a good reputation for doing good work.  The 6105B hacking movement is all original and has been cleaned and serviced...dial, hands, and bezel insert are new, and the case has seen some light repolishing, brushing work to spiff up the appearance a bit.
